Skip to Main Content
Ready to Move Forward
Call Us 1-866-910-4833
Sign In
Toggle navigation
Sign In
Products
Generators
Sheds
How It Works
Authorized Providers
Customer Pledge
Preparing for Your Project
Free Estimate
Thank You!
We will notify your certified contractor, so that they can follow-up with you.